Opportunity: This is more than just a job; it’s a mission. We are seeking an experienced Elasticsearch Platforms Engineer to join our Data Platforms Infrastructure team. This role is pivotal in supporting and maintaining our Elastic Cloud Enterprise (ECE) environment, designing and deploying Elastic solutions for Observability and Search, and ensuring the highest standards of security, privacy, and compliance. The ideal candidate will have a strong background in Elasticsearch, a keen understanding of cloud architecture, and a proven track record of managing and optimizing large-scale Elastic deployments.

Role responsibilities:

  • ECE Support and Maintenance: Manage, monitor, and maintain Elastic Cloud Enterprise (ECE) environments. Perform routine updates, patches, and upgrades to ensure optimal performance and security. Troubleshoot and resolve issues related to Elasticsearch clusters, indices, and ECE infrastructure.
  • Design and Deployment: Design scalable and efficient Elasticsearch solutions for Observability and Search use cases. Implement best practices for data indexing, storage, and retrieval. Work with stakeholders to understand requirements and translate them into technical solutions.
  • Security, Privacy, and Compliance: Implement and enforce security measures to protect Elasticsearch data, including access controls, encryption, and monitoring. Ensure compliance with relevant data protection regulations and industry standards (e.g., GDPR, HIPAA). Conduct regular security audits and vulnerability assessments.
  • Performance Optimization: Monitor and analyse the performance of Elasticsearch clusters and indices. Optimize configurations and queries to improve performance and reduce latency. Implement effective indexing strategies and shard allocation for balanced workloads.
  • Collaboration and Support: Collaborate with DevOps, Security, and Development teams to integrate Elasticsearch with other systems and applications. Provide expert support and guidance to development teams on Elasticsearch-related projects. Develop and maintain documentation, including architecture diagrams, operational procedures, and troubleshooting guides.
  • Innovation and Continuous Improvement: Stay updated with the latest features and updates in the Elasticsearch ecosystem. Identify opportunities for automation and improvement in Elasticsearch deployment and management processes. Lead initiatives to integrate new technologies and practices that enhance the Elasticsearch platform.

We are looking for:

  • Strong understanding of Elasticsearch architecture, components, and APIs.
  • Experience with designing and deploying Elasticsearch for Observability and Search use cases.
  • Knowledge of security best practices and compliance requirements (e.g., GDPR, HIPAA).
  • Proficiency in scripting and automation (e.g., Python, Bash, Ansible).
  • Familiarity with cloud platforms (e.g., AWS, Azure, GCP) and container orchestration (e.g., Kubernetes).
  • Excellent problem-solving skills and the ability to troubleshoot complex issues.
  • Strong communication and collaboration skills.
  • Experience in Cloudera, Hadoop, Cloudera Data Science Workbench (CDSW), Cloudera Machine Learning (CML) would be highly desirable.
